How to grow azaleas and what to do with fallen leaves

1. Breeding methods

1. Soil: When planting, use soil with high air permeability and good drainage ability, and the fertility of the cultivation soil should be sufficient. It is best to use acidic soil, which is helpful for its growth.

2. Temperature: Create a growing environment of 12-25℃ for it, and maintain the temperature between 18-25℃ during April-September. In addition, the air circulation in the maintenance environment should be good.

3. Water: It likes a slightly humid growing environment. It needs to be watered more frequently during its growing period, and it should also be sprayed with water appropriately to keep it moist. Usually water it once every 2-3 days, twice a day in summer, and no watering during the rainy days.

2. Leaf fall treatment method

When the azalea sheds its leaves, you should consider whether there is something wrong with its maintenance.

1. If the cultivation soil used is alkaline, its roots will wilt and the leaves will fall off. The most direct way to deal with this situation is to change the soil and replace it with fertile acidic soil.

2. When the plants are attacked by diseases and pests, such as scale insects and brown spot disease, they will also lose leaves. We need to purchase medicines for prevention and control in time according to the types of diseases and pests.

3. If you water too much during maintenance, its roots will be soaked in stagnant water and will rot, causing the leaves to fall off. The soil should be loosened appropriately and ventilation should be enhanced.
